STEPHENVILLE, TEXAS -- SUU couldn't find enough scoring to keep up with the hot-shooting Texans and fell 58-75.
Head Coach Rob Jeter said
"We know what we have to do to win these ball games with the guys we are missing, and we haven't been able to do it. We are short-handed offensively so we have to be a lot better on the defensive side of the ball."
Top T-Birds
- Jamir Simpson led all scorers with 24 points on 8-15 from the floor, 2-2 from three, and 6-6 from the free throw line.
- Hercy Miller scored 11 points on 7-8 from the free throw line.
- Brock Felder led the team in rebounds with 5 to go along with a block and a steal.
Game Recap
The short-handed T-Birds hung around for a while in the first half, trailing by just four with 10 minutes remaining. But a 10-4 run by the Texans over the next five minutes saw the lead balloon, and they took a 14-point lead into the break.Â
Seven quick points from Simpson cut into the TSU lead, and then back-to-back buckets by Xavier Sykes got it to single digits for the first time in the second half.Â
As has been the case with Dominique Ford and Tavi Jackson out, the Thunderbirds went on an extended scoring drought and were held without a point over the next five minutes, and the lead was back to 18 with 7:30 remaining.Â
SUU was unable to sustain another run and fell to 1-7 in WAC play.
